How come the diamonds don't take personal responsibilty for IBOs who follow the system and don't go diamond or platinum?
Is "personal responsibility" the new buzzword for one of the LOS? That's cropping up everywhere.
I've seen that phrase so much lately, and also the "winners will win despite the situation." It's really obviously a way of spinning that the system abuses are known, but if you left (ie. failed) it was still your fault because a) you didn't research with due diligence (your "personal responsibility") and b) even with the documented abuses, a real winner could still prevail, no matter what!
I find it interesting that so many people are parroting this statements, which are really admissions to the most common criticisms.

Actually, Christian, you have it wrong. Teen mentality, grammar doesn't matter (LOL/ROFLMAO/BRB and all other shortcuts I don't understand). But, by business mentality, how and what we write are just as important as what we say, and how we look.
Are we more apt to believe a person wearing tattered clothes and speaking slang, or a person wearing a suit, speaking eloquently? Same thing when writing. Are we to trust a person who doesn't use punctuation and comes off undeducated, or someone who knows the MLS (Modern Language Society) Handbook backwards and forwards?
The business teaches, rightfully so I might add, that appearances matter. Your written communication is a big part of appearances, especially in today's business world. As someone who often communicates to customers as part of my job, every email, letter, and other correspondance I send at least goes through spell check, and most go through our in-house copywriter to make sure there are no errors, and that I sound professional.
